Output ef31bf86cb2521261db7810b5ca4e1fa3955d1663fcd8385d0e6cfcdaaa38291:3

value
39356
script pubkey
OP_0 OP_PUSHBYTES_20 271f7faf94edc77e8b87fc16747626b0661aece5
address
bc1qyu0hltu5ahrhazu8lst8ga3xkpnp4m899xywda
transaction
ef31bf86cb2521261db7810b5ca4e1fa3955d1663fcd8385d0e6cfcdaaa38291